The Surgical Procedure: Step-by-Step



When you've completed the pre-surgery preparations, the surgical procedure itself will certainly start.

You'll be taken to the operating room, where you'll rest conveniently. mouse click the next web page will start by administering numbing eye declines, guaranteeing you won't really feel any kind of discomfort.

Next off, they'll position a little tool to keep your eye open. Utilizing a laser, the surgeon will certainly produce a slim flap on the cornea, then delicately raise it.

Afterwards, they'll improve your cornea with precision lasers, remedying your vision. As soon as the improving is complete, the flap is repositioned, and you'll be assisted to kick back while the treatment wraps up.

The entire process usually takes around 15 mins per eye, so you'll be in and out before you know it.

Post-Operative Care and Healing Tips



Looking after your eyes after surgical procedure is critical for a smooth healing. Initially, follow your surgeon's guidelines closely relating to drugs and eye decreases. You'll wish to keep your eyes oiled and devoid of infection.

Prevent massaging your eyes and secure them from intense lights and dust by putting on sunglasses when outdoors. Relax is crucial; provide your eyes a break from displays and reading for the initial few days.

Don't neglect to attend your follow-up visits to track your development. If you experience any type of uncommon discomfort, inflammation, or vision adjustments, call your doctor promptly.
